Hey Badger,
Go for the Civic!! Auris - Power=174, 0-60=7.8 seconds, MPG=45, insurance group=13 Civic - Power=140, 0-60=8.3 seconds, MPG=55, insurance group=10 Civic is the much better choice, the extra 34bhp only takes half a second off the 0-60 sprint, and you pay for that extra insurance and the higher fuel consumption! Much better all-rounder. Sure the Civic is cheaper also. Last edited by sambuca2907; 25th October 2007 at 16:22. |
